Problems with Automatic Classification of Musical Sounds
Convenient searching of multimedia databases requires well annotated data. Labeling sound data with information like pitch or timbre must be done through sound analysis. In this paper, we deal with the problem of automatic classification of musical instrument on the basis of its sound. Automatic fish classification problem is exposed and justified. The latter belongs to the domain of pattern recognition, more specificly object recognition. A closed set automatic fish classifier is implemented and observed to work with a reasonable accuracy. In this paper, a classification scheme has been proposed to classify crackles based on waveform features and frequency domain features. This purpose is very important in the analysis of respiratory disorders. In fact, morphological characters of crackles can be well represented by time amplitude distribution.
